Events
- 1990: Antonis Tritsis defeats actress-activist Melina Mercouri and is elected Mayor of Athens. Tritsis received 50.15% of the vote against Mercouri's 45.94%.
- 1992: Forest fires break out in Chania prefecture, Crete.
- 2004: Two F-16 aircraft of the Hellenic Airforce crash on Pelion mountains in thick fog.
Sports
- 2009: Greece qualify for the playoffs, in their World Cup 2010 campaign, by defeating Luxembourg 2-1.
Births
- 1937: Kostas Sfikas, athlete (triple jump)
Deaths
- 1995: Eleni Vlachou, publisher, anti-Junta activist.
